Silicon Valley’s Aska will unveil a full-size prototype of the vehicle which is pretty much an electric car and quadcopter rolled into one. Some of the salient features of the car include:
– Four-seater
– VTOL – Vertical Takeoff and Landing
– STOL – Short Takeoff and Landing
– Full electric system with range extender (lithium-ion batteries + engine)
– Flight range up to 400 km
– Flight speed up to 240 kph
– The company is aiming for highway certification with a speed of 112 kph while in drive mode. It also specifies that the first deliveries may be limited to local roads.
Speaking of electric mobility at CES 2023, China’s Davinci will be unveiling the DC100, its first electric motorcycle developed to rival the traditional 1,000cc motorcycle class. Not only does the company promise a performance orientation but also long range.
This electric motorcycle can sprint from 0-100 km/h in three seconds before topping out at 200 km/h. At the same time, it boasts a range of over 400 km, while it takes just half an hour to juice its battery fully using level 3 DC fast-charging stations.
